WebHyaline membranes are characterized by the presence of dense eosinophilic amorphous material plastered along the alveolar septa; these eosinophilic structures are composed of cellular debris, plasma proteins (albumin, fibrinogen, and immunoglobulins), and surfactant components (7, 8, 10, 12, 14, 25, 26). Web5 jun. 2024 · Hyalinosis lesions are common in diabetic nephropathy and result from insudation or exudation of plasma proteins from the vessels. They have a homogenous eosinophilic appearance and show two characteristic patterns: fibrin cap and capsular drop.
